Its monday, the 29th Ofjuly. Our main story. It was a dramatic second day at the olympics for Team Gb, winning two medals in the swimming And kayak. Adam peaty won silver in the 100m Breaststroke final Last Night missing out on gold by 200ths Of a second, while Kimberley Woods won bronze in the womens kayak single. Joe lynskey reports. For eight years, Adam Peaty has pushed his sport to new limits. Hes not used to silver but he now has perspective. In the 100m Breaststroke, he went for a third gold in the row And britains first at these games. He missed out by a margin, two hundredths Of a second. Commentator The Gold has gone to martinenghi Of italy. And a joint silver medal, its gone to Adam Peaty Of great britain. Less than two years ago, he said this sport had broken him. To get so close might have felt cruel. But, for peaty, the Breakthrough Wasjust to be here. Its just incredibly hard. Like, to win it once And to win it again then to win it again. For continuing Coverage And Analysis from our team of correspondents in the uk and around the world. Good evening from southport, where there is Shock And Grief tonight. Two children are dead and nine other children injured six critically following what police describe as a ferocious knife attack. It happened shortly before midday at a Taylor Swift themed Summer Holiday Dance class. It was for primary School Age children. Two adults are also in a critical condition after being injured during the incident police say they tried to protect the children. Tonight, a 17 year old male suspect is in custody. Police say the motive remains unclear and are not treating it as a Terrorist Incident at this moment in time. Lets explain some of what we know. The Dance Class had been taking place on hart street, a quiet residential area in the Seaside Town of southport, when the attack happened. That was at 11. 50.
